Marcello Foa, (Milano, 30 September 1963) is an Italian journalist and writer with Italian-Swiss citizenship. Dal 26 September 2018 he is president of RAI.
Presents: The Wizards of the News. Act II. How information is produced at the service of governments, Guerini and Associates; 21st edition (14 March 2018)
Politicians are truly under the thumb of the media in a society obsessed with the excessive power of information? In reality, governments have learned to use the apparent supremacy of the press to their advantage thanks to spin doctors, the modern “news wizards”.
In this essay, Marcello Foa updates and expands the text of 2006. The author explains how and why it is possible to direct and, if necessary, manipulate information, often without the knowledge of the journalists themselves. Full of anecdotes and background on major recent events − from the war in Iraq to the one in Syria, from Renzi to Macron to fake news − clearly reveals the logic, the techniques, the tricks used by great persuaders in the service of institutions. The book overturns many clichés about the Fourth Estate with intellectual honesty. A text for those who want to understand the role and mysteries of the world of information.
Enrica Perucchietti, (Torino, 5 December 1979) is an Italian journalist and writer. She is the editor-in-chief of the UNO publishing group. She is the author of numerous successful essays among which we remember: Fake news; Global governance; The manipulation factory; Unisex; False Flag. Under a false flag. Presents: Fake news. From the manipulation of public opinion to post-truth: how power controls the media and fabricates information to obtain consensus, Arianna Publishing, April 2018.
Foreword by Marcello Foa.
Enrica Perucchietti returns to analyze the relationship between the means of communication, power and strategies of social control, showing how the first to lie to public opinion are the mainstream media. «We are largely governed by men of whom we know nothing, but which are capable of shaping our mentality, guide our tastes, suggest what to think». Thus wrote the father of the science of Public Relations Edward Bernays in 1928 in the incipit of the essay Propagandaa, explaining that there is an invisible power that directs the opinions and habits of the masses in democratic systems.
What has changed over the decades and how the techniques of social control have evolved? How power creates consensus and guides citizens' choices?
How does the current battle over fake news fit into this mechanism??
An attempt is being made to introduce the crime of opinion and to censor independent information? What is post-truth?
Taking up and updating the main themes of George Orwell's masterpiece, 1984, the author shows how the battle against fake news intends to repress dissent and censor independent information, introducing − in fact − thought crime and preventing people not only from expressing themselves, but even to think.
